Step 1
Turn on your stove broiler to heat the oven while you prep.
Step 2
Butterfly the lobster tails and rest the meat on top of the shell.
Step 3
Brush the lobster meat with clarified butter then season with Old Bay seasoning. Place the tails on a lined sheet pan and place into the oven.
Step 4
Broil the lobster tails 8 to 10 minutes until done. Extra large lobster tails may take a few minutes more. The meat should be pinkish white but firm and the shells bright red when done.
Step 5
Serve with clarified butter.
